Milk + jaggery + flour offering to Naga deities
Noorum Palum (ಪಾಲುಂ ನೂರುಂ | നൂറും പാലും — 'flour and milk') is the keystone Naga offering on Ashlesha (Ayilyam) nakshatra. A paste of rice flour + jaggery + milk is poured over the Naga vigraha — a serene offering to the serpent guardians. Particularly powerful for those observing Sarpa Dosha remedies or seeking the Nagas' blessings for family wellbeing.
Monthly Naga & Subramanya observance on Ashlesha star
Ayilya Pooja (ಆಯಿಲ್ಯಂ ಪೂಜೆ (ಆಶ್ಲೇಷಾ ನಕ್ಷತ್ರ) | आयिल्य पूजा) is the formal devotional rite performed on Ashlesha (Ayilyam) nakshatra each month — sacred to the Nagas and to Lord Subramanya. Devotees attend for family prosperity, fertility blessings, and remedies for Sarpa Dosha and Kuja Dosha. The pooja includes archana, dhupam, deeparadhana, and a special prasada offering.
Turmeric abhishekam for Bhagavati / Naga deities
Manjal Abhishekam (ಅರಿಶಿನ ಅಭಿಷೇಕ | हल्दी अभिषेक | മഞ്ഞൾ അഭിഷേകം — 'turmeric abishekam') is the sacred turmeric-paste anointing of the deity, traditionally performed for Bhagavati and the Nagas. The cooling, healing properties of turmeric are offered to the deity with chants — a particularly auspicious abhishekam on Ayilyam day.
